Abstract
The invention discloses fish feeding equipment for aquaculture, and relates to the technical field of fishery. The novel motor support comprises a fixing plate, wherein a connecting rod is fixed on one side of the fixing plate, a first baffle is fixed at one end of the connecting rod, a first rotating shaft is fixed inside the first baffle, a first supporting rod is fixed on the inner ring of the first rotating shaft, a driven wheel is fixed at one end of the first supporting rod, a second rotating shaft is fixed on one side of the inner wall of the first baffle, a second supporting rod is fixed on the inner ring of the second rotating shaft, a driving wheel is fixed at one end of the second supporting rod, a third rotating shaft is fixed on the outer side of the second supporting rod, a second baffle is fixed on the outer ring of the third rotating shaft, and a motor is fixed at one end of the second supporting rod. According to the fish feeding device, the bottom of the feeding device is provided with the relatively thin food outlet, so that fish food can slowly fall into a lake, the device can feed the fish without manpower, time and labor are saved, meanwhile, the fish in the center of the lake can be fed, and the feeding efficiency is improved.

Technical Field
The invention belongs to the technical field of fishery, and particularly relates to fish feeding equipment for aquaculture.
Background
Fishery refers to the social production sector that catches and breeds fish and other aquatic animals and aquatic plants such as marine algae to obtain aquatic products. Generally, the method is divided into marine fishery and fresh water fishery. The fishery industry can provide food and industrial raw materials for people's life and national construction.
Generally, when fish is cultured, workers are required to manually feed the fish, and the method is time-consuming and labor-wasting.

Referring to fig. 1-6, the present invention is a fish feeding device for aquaculture, comprising a fixing plate 1, a connecting rod 2 fixed on one side of the fixing plate 1, a first baffle 3 fixed on one end of the connecting rod 2, a first rotating shaft 4 fixed inside the first baffle 3, and a first supporting rod 5 fixed on the inner ring of the first rotating shaft 4;
a driven wheel 6 is fixed at one end of the first supporting rod 5, a second rotating shaft 7 is fixed on one side of the inner wall of the first baffle plate 3, a second supporting rod 8 is fixed on the inner ring of the second rotating shaft 7, a driving wheel 9 is fixed at one end of the second supporting rod 8, a third rotating shaft 10 is fixed on the outer side of the second supporting rod 8, a second baffle plate 11 is fixed on the outer ring of the third rotating shaft 10, and a motor 12 is fixed at one end of the second supporting rod 8;
a positioning rod 13 is fixed between the fixed plate 1 and the second baffle plate 11;
a transmission belt 14 is sleeved on the outer sides of the driving wheel 9 and the driven wheel 6, a movable rod 15 is fixed at one end of the transmission belt 14, and a feeder 16 is fixed at one end of the movable rod 15;
the upper surface of the feeder 16 is movably connected with a box cover 17, and the bottom of the feeder 16 is fixed with a food outlet 18;
a base 19 is fixed on one side of the fixed plate 1, and a floating plate 20 is fixed on one side of the base 19.
As shown in fig. 6, a limiting rod 21 is fixed at one end of the movable rod 15, a limiting block 22 is fixed at one end of the limiting rod 21, and the limiting block 22 is of a spherical structure.
As shown in fig. 6, a limiting groove 23 is movably connected to the outer side of the limiting block 22, and a sliding plate 24 is fixed to one end of the limiting groove 23.
As shown in fig. 6, an adjusting lever 25 is fixed to one side of the sliding plate 24, a limiting plate 26 is fixed to one end of the adjusting lever 25, and the adjusting lever 25 penetrates through a gap between the fixed plate 1 and the first blocking plate 3.
As shown in fig. 6, a protection groove 27 is fixed on one side of the limit plate 26, a protection block 28 is connected inside the protection groove 27 in a rolling manner, and the protection block 28 is of a spherical structure.
The working principle of the embodiment is as follows: when the fish feeding device is used, fish food is put into the food throwing device 16, the box cover 17 is covered, the floating plate 20 is put into water, the device is enabled to float on the water surface, the motor 12 is turned on, the motor 12 drives the driving wheel 9 to rotate, the driving wheel 9 rotates and simultaneously drives the driving belt 14 on the outer side of the driving wheel to rotate, the driving belt 14 drives the movable rod 15 on one side of the driving belt to rotate, the movable rod 15 drives the food throwing device 16 to move, the fish in the water pool is thrown, meanwhile, the bottom of the food throwing device 16 is provided with the small food outlet 18, the fish food can slowly fall into a lake, the fish feeding device can feed the fish without manpower, time and labor are saved, meanwhile, the fish in the center of the lake can be thrown, and the feeding efficiency is improved.
